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Cable length matters: At 50 feet, you need low-resistance conductors to avoid signal degradation; pure copper is ideal over copper-clad aluminum (CCA) for long runs.
  • Color coding with red, yellow, green, and blue cables helps quickly identify which mic is which on a busy stage, reducing setup errors during live performances.
  • Ensure the XLR connectors are plated (nickel or gold) to resist corrosion and maintain a secure connection, especially if cables are frequently plugged and unplugged.

What Our Analysts Recommend

Quality XLR cables should have 100% shielding (braided or foil) to reject hum and radio interference, especially at longer lengths like 50ft. Look for strain relief boots on both male and female ends to prevent cable failure at the connector joint, a common failure point.

Common Issues

Many budget XLR cables use copper-clad aluminum (CCA) instead of pure copper, leading to higher resistance and signal loss over long runs. Poorly soldered connectors or missing strain relief are frequent causes of intermittent audio dropouts in live settings.

Quality Indicators

Look for cables that specify 'pure copper' or 'OFC' conductors—this product's pure copper claim is a strong quality sign. Plated XLR pins (nickel or gold) and a flexible yet durable PVC jacket also indicate better build quality and longevity.
